Catalyzes the formation of formate and 2-keto-4-methylthiobutyrate (KMTB) from 1,2-dihydroxy-3-keto-5-methylthiopentene (DHK-MTPene). Also down-regulates cell migration mediated by MMP14. Necessary for hepatitis C virus replication in an otherwise non-permissive cell line.
Gene References into Functions
High ADI1 expression is associated with malignant glioma. PMID: 30066900
The thermal stability of the HsARD isozymes is a function of the metal ion identity, with Ni2+-bound HsARD being the most stable followed by Co2+ and Fe2+, and Mn2+-bound HsARD being the least stable. PMID: 28062648
In summary, clinical and cell-based experiments suggested that physical interaction between MT1-MMP and ADI1 led to suppression of hepatitis C virus infection. This inhibitory effect could be reversed by ADI1 overexpression. PMID: 26537061
Data elucidate a new role for MTCBP-1 regulating the intracellular function of MT1-MMP-mediated autophagy. Their inverse expression correlation with brain tumor grades could also contribute to the decreased autophagic index observed in high-grade tumors. PMID: 25640948
MTCBP-1 is a new member of the Cupin superfamily with a role as an invasion suppressor down-regulated in tumors PMID: 14718544
nucleo-cytoplasmic transport of hADI1 is regulated by a non-canonical nuclear export signal (NES) located in the N-terminal region of hADI1. PMID: 17212658
ADI1 may check prostate cancer progression through apoptosis by an activity that does not require metal binding. PMID: 17786183
293-ADI1-CD81 cells are permissive for serum-derived HCV infection. PMID: 19626614

Subcellular Location
Cytoplasm. Nucleus. Cell membrane; Peripheral membrane protein; Cytoplasmic side. Note=Localizes to the plasma membrane when complexed to MMP14.
Protein Families
Acireductone dioxygenase (ARD) family
Tissue Specificity
Detected in heart, colon, lung, stomach, brain, spleen, liver, skeletal muscle and kidney.
